Few issues in recent political memory have aroused as much passion as the West Valley Mission Community College District's $68 million bond proposal, Measure E. And nowhere has the battle been waged more fiercely than in Saratoga, home to the West Valley College campus. On March 5, voters will go to the polls to decide the fate of Measure E. Over the past few weeks, the Saratoga News has covered this story in the news pages and in expanded commentary pages. In this final week before the election, we extended an invitation to both sides to submit their best arguments in 600 words.
